Updated measurement of the $e^+e^- \to ωπ^0 \to π^0π^0γ$ cross section with the SND detector

arXiv:1610.00235 · doi:10.1103/PhysRevD.94.112001

Abstract

We analyze a 37 pb$^{-1}$ data sample collected with the SND detector at the VEPP-2000 $e^+e^-$ collider in the center-of-mass energy range 1.05--2.00 GeV and present an updated measurement of the $e^+e^- \to ωπ^0 \to π^0π^0γ$ cross section. In particular, we correct the mistake in radiative correction calculation made in our previous measurement based on a part of the data. The measured cross section is fitted with the vector meson dominance model with three $ρ$-like states and used to test the conserved vector current hypothesis in the $τ^-\toωπ^-ν_τ$ decay.
